Kevin Brereton: 'Little did I know that five years later, I'd be falling in love with my best friend', Kevin and Rachael - 2010

May 15, 2015

Uploaded 11 July 2010, United Kingdom

Give me a P-I-R Arrrrrrh

Distinguished guests, family friends and JT.

Rachael and I would like to thank you for joining us to celebrate our special day with us. I can honestly say it wouldn’t have been the same without you. It would have been considerably cheaper ...

Firstly I’d like to say a big thank you to John and pat for producing such a beautiful, strong, intelligent, and independent daughter.

John, thanks for the warning about the extreme physical violence I would receive should I not treat Rachael in the manner she deserves.

But you can trust me when I say that I will always love her, and protect her.

I’d like to thank John and Pat for welcoming me into their family. I feel totally at home with them. Although Pat, I don’t think it’s necessary for you to do those naked bombs on me at the villa.

Talking of Pat, would you mind standing up please, do a twirl so everyone can see you, okay that’s enough of that, you give her a little bit of limelight...

I’m sure you’ll all agree that Pat looks absolutely stunning today.

Now they say, that if you want to know what you’re wife’s going to look like when she’s older, just look to the mother. Well Pat, I’m looking -- and I’m liking.

Mum and Dad -- I’d like to thank you for producing such an incredible son. I know, I know, you can’t believe how fortunate you are to have me, but as everybody here today knows, this isn’t about me, it’s about Rachael.

Seriously though, you’ve always been there when I needed you, and supported me through everything I’ve done and thank you for that. 

I’m sure you’ll all agree that Rachael looks absolutely incredible, amazing today. Seeing you walk down the aisle made me think that maybe I’m the one whose got the best out of this deal.

Believe it or not ... did I say it the wrong way round?

Knew I should have read the card.

Now believe it or not, one of us in this relationship can be quite arrogant.

They can also be pig headed, stubborn -- they think they know it all from how to cut grass, to how things should operate in the bedroom. But luckily for me, Rachael has been patient, open and willing to learn.

On a serious note, though, I’d like everyone to know how lucky I feel to have Rachael as my partner in life.

We met 13 years ago, and quickly grew to be very close.

Little did I know that five years later, I’d be falling in love with my best friend.

I remember our first night spent together at Vicki’s house. Which at the time had no doors on the bedrooms, I’m really sorry Vicki. [Inaudible]

And thinking Rach might take me too seriously, I uttered those immortal words, ‘Rach, I just want you to know, this is just for fun.’ Can you say, fucking hell?

Unfortunately for me, Vicki was listening in the next room, and I was subjected to a huge amount of abuse for the next six months. Or was it four years? However it wasn’t really just for fun because within two weeks I’d fallen head over heels, and the rest, as they say, is history.

Rachael is caring funny intelligent and beautiful, I’m so lucky that you lowered yourself, to me.

I’ve had the best eight years of my life with you, and I’m looking forward to spending the rest of my days by your side.

I must say it’s not always easy being Rachael partner. I try to keep myself in shape for her over the years. Is she dissatisfied with my body? A tiny part of me says yes.

Rachael, thank you for marrying me and loving me so much.

Ladies and gentleman, please be upstanding for probably the most important toast I’ll ever make.

To my life and my absolute world -- to Rachael.

And there’s more. Finish on a peak they say.

Leah, thank you for being the best bridesmaid we could have ever hoped for. You look absolutely stunning today, which I’m sure everyone has said.

And we’d like to give you a gift, but not just for being a great bridesmaid, but for being a wonderful daughter as well.  It’s a load of Tesco’s shopping bags.

I’d also like to thank Helen, Vicki, Jo and Lucy, for all the help organising Rachael ahead of today. Although she can be quite well organised, when it came to this wedding, she genuinely didn’t know that we were supposed to have a guest book, or even a wedding cake.

Thanks to Pearce, Ali and Andrew for being my ushers today. There wasn’t much for you to do but look good, and although you might have let me down somewhat on that front. I understand that you tried your best.

Kim, some more tears might be coming here. I want to thank Kim for agreeing to be my best man. We’ve shared some of the best times together over the last eighteen years, [video runs out]
